UKG Test Candidate
About This Job As a UKG Test Candidate, you play a critical role in ensuring the reliability and accuracy of our Human Resources, Payroll, and Workforce Management systems.
You safeguard the integrity of our data and processes, directly impacting our employees' experience and operational efficiency.
This position drives quality assurance initiatives, validates system functionality, and ensures our UKG platforms perform flawlessly.
You collaborate closely with various teams to deliver robust and dependable solutions that support our organizational goals.
Job Duties and Responsibilities Designs and executes comprehensive test plans and cases for UKG Pro and UKG Dimensions modules, including HRIS, Payroll Processing, and Workforce Management (WFM).Identifies, documents, and tracks system defects and inconsistencies, working with development teams to ensure timely resolution.Leads and supports User Acceptance Testing (UAT) cycles, guiding end-users through testing processes and gathering critical feedback.Performs thorough Regression Testing to confirm that new system changes do not negatively impact existing functionalities.Conducts Data Validation to ensure accuracy and completeness of information within UKG systems.Collaborates with business analysts, developers, and project managers to understand requirements and translate them into effective test strategies.Maintains detailed test documentation, including test cases, test results, and defect reports.Contributes to the continuous improvement of testing processes and methodologies.
Required Qualifications Education Holds a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, Human Resources, Business Administration, or a related field.
Experience Possesses relevant experience in Quality Assurance (QA) or User Acceptance Testing (UAT) roles.Applies practical experience with HRIS, Payroll Processing, or Workforce Management (WFM) systems.Demonstrates direct experience with UKG Pro and/or UKG Dimensions.
Knowledge/Skills Understands and applies principles of Quality Assurance (QA) and testing methodologies.Develops effective Test Case Development strategies.Facilitates and manages User Acceptance Testing (UAT) processes.Executes and analyzes Regression Testing.Performs Data Validation techniques with precision.Possesses strong functional knowledge of UKG Pro.Understands the capabilities and configurations of UKG Dimensions.Applies knowledge of HRIS functionalities and best practices.Comprehends Payroll Processing workflows and requirements.Understands Workforce Management (WFM) concepts and system applications.Exhibits strong analytical and problem-solving skills, identifying root causes and proposing solutions.Communicates complex technical information clearly and concisely, both verbally and in writing.
Preferred Qualifications Holds a relevant professional certification in Quality Assurance or UKG systems.Works effectively in an Agile development environment.
